The Trinity Unveiled : Encountering God in Three Persons
Overview
THE TRINITY UNVEILED is a comprehensive exploration of Christianity's central mystery-the Triune God. Covering more than 2,000 years of history and theology in a clear, story-like narrative, this book leads readers through Scripture, the writings of the Church Fathers, the debates of Nicaea and Constantinople, and the reflections of modern theologians.
Written for both scholars and everyday believers, it explains Hebrew and Greek terms with pronunciation and transliteration, includes detailed quotes from the Fathers, and provides modern applications for prayer, community, and mission.
Readers will encounter the Trinity not as an abstract puzzle but as the living God who creates, redeems, and indwells His people:
God With Us in the Son who became flesh.
God For Us in the Father who loves and saves.
God Within Us in the Spirit who dwells in believers.
With appendices including a glossary of Hebrew and Greek terms, a timeline of councils and creeds, and a collection of patristic quotes, this book is an invaluable resource for study, teaching, and worship.
